S30.827S
ICD-10-CMThis code signifies a non-thermal blister formation specifically located on the anus, indicating a long-term or residual effect of a previous injury or condition. It represents a skin lesion characterized by a fluid-filled sac, not caused by heat or cold exposure, that has persisted or developed as a consequence of an earlier event.
This code is appropriate for documenting a patient presenting with an anal blister that is clearly identified as a sequela, meaning it is a late effect of an initial injury or disease process. Examples include blisters arising years after a traumatic anal injury, a resolved infection, or a previous dermatological condition affecting the perianal area.
